Transaction ce32acd6b51a329ea731014049b9b8aef5012365519496d964080c63d80aedf4
1 Input
1 Outputs
- ce32acd6b51a329ea731014049b9b8aef5012365519496d964080c63d80aedf4:0
value 5681850
address 38Pffennu1ncX4xKwiufuk2M8ua1EcgwGp